在数字化转型的浪潮中,编程技能已经成为了现代社会必备的基本素养。OPSS,即Open Programming Scripting System,是一个功能强大的编程语言,广泛应用于各种脚本编写、自动化处理以及系统集成等领域。无论你是编程新手还是有经验的开发者,掌握OPSS编程技巧都无疑会为你的职业生涯增添一笔宝贵的财富。本文将带你从零开始,深入了解OPSS编程技巧,并通过实战案例帮助你轻松入门。
一、OPSS基础入门
1.1 OPSS简介
OPSS是一种基于Python语言的编程语言,具有易学易用、跨平台、功能丰富等特点。它可以在多种操作系统上运行,包括Windows、Linux、macOS等。
1.2 OPSS安装与配置
Windows平台:
- 访问OPSS官方网站下载适用于Windows平台的安装包。
- 运行安装包,按照提示完成安装。
Linux和macOS平台:
- 使用包管理工具(如apt、yum、brew等)安装OPSS。
1.3 OPSS开发环境
- 集成开发环境(IDE):推荐使用PyCharm、Visual Studio Code等支持Python的IDE。
- 文本编辑器:Notepad++、Sublime Text等也可作为开发环境。
二、OPSS编程基础
2.1 数据类型
OPSS支持多种数据类型,如数字、字符串、列表、元组、字典等。
- 数字:整数、浮点数等。
- 字符串:文本数据,如“Hello, OPSS!”。
- 列表:有序集合,元素可以是任何数据类型。
- 元组:不可变序列,元素可以是任何数据类型。
- 字典:键值对集合,键是唯一的。
2.2 控制结构
- 条件语句:if-else、elif。
- 循环语句:for、while。
2.3 函数
函数是OPSS中的核心组成部分,可以封装重复执行的代码块,提高代码复用性。
三、OPSS实战案例
3.1 自动化办公
以下是一个使用OPSS编写的小脚本,可以自动打开Excel文档并读取数据:
import openpyxl
# 打开Excel文档
wb = openpyxl.load_workbook('data.xlsx')
sheet = wb.active
# 读取数据
for row in sheet.iter_rows(min_row=1, max_col=3, max_row=10):
for cell in row:
print(cell.value)
3.2 网络爬虫
以下是一个使用OPSS编写的小爬虫脚本,可以抓取指定网站的数据:
import requests
# 指定要抓取的网站URL
url = 'http://example.com'
# 发送GET请求
response = requests.get(url)
# 解析HTML文档
from bs4 import BeautifulSoup
soup = BeautifulSoup(response.text, 'html.parser')
# 提取指定元素
for title in soup.find_all('title'):
print(title.get_text())
3.3 自动化测试
以下是一个使用OPSS编写的自动化测试脚本,可以检查网站是否存在错误:
import requests
from bs4 import BeautifulSoup
# 指定要测试的网站URL
url = 'http://example.com'
# 发送GET请求
response = requests.get(url)
# 检查HTTP状态码
if response.status_code == 200:
print("网站运行正常")
else:
print("网站出现错误,状态码:", response.status_code)
四、总结
通过本文的介绍,相信你已经对OPSS编程技巧有了初步的了解。从基础入门到实战案例,我们一步步帮助你掌握OPSS编程。当然,这只是冰山一角,更多高级技巧和实际应用需要你在实践中不断摸索。祝你早日成为一名OPSS编程高手!
